It is not needed in this case. The Huntmaster is only a 3/3 green Elf Warrior creature permanent with an ability while it is on the battlefield. On the stack it is a green Elf Warrior creature spell with CMC 4 and everywhere else it is a green Elf Warrior creature card with CMC 4.
If static abilities would already be active while the card is on the stack, the game would break open spilling out eldrazi-shaped madness

Depends on the wording.
"Whenever you play an Elf spell other than Lys Alana Huntsmaster..." would still trigger on playing other Huntsmasters whereas
"Whenever you play an Elf spell not named Lys Alana Huntsmaster..." would not.
Whenever a card refers to itself by name (you could replace the name with 'this card' and it fits fine) it doesn't apply to other cards with the same name. When talking about all copies of a specific card the template used refers to cards with the same name specifically.
But, of course, that ability isn't static anyways. It's a triggered ability, and those can only go off if they are in their proper zone (battlefield unless explicitly specified on the card) at the moment the triggering event takes place. So Huntsmaster doesn't trigger off itself because it's not on the battlefield when the triggering event (itself being cast) takes place.
